The Revolut problem-solving interview

The round that decides most Revolut loops — and the one people prepare for least well.

The Revolut problem-solving interview is a 45–60 minute live case discussion where you're given an ambiguous business problem and assessed on how you structure it, not whether you reach the "right" answer. Strong candidates clarify the goal first, break the problem into a small number of non-overlapping drivers, state a hypothesis early, and narrate their reasoning out loud throughout.

What the round actually is

You get a problem with deliberately incomplete information. The interviewer is not looking for the answer — they're looking at whether your thinking is structured, whether you notice what information is missing, and whether you can be corrected without losing the thread.

How it's scored

What they assessA weak answerA strong answer
Clarifying the goalStarts solving immediatelyEstablishes what "good" means before structuring
StructureA list of scattered ideas3–4 non-overlapping drivers, stated upfront
PrioritisationExplores everything equallySays which branch matters most, and why
Handling dataWaits to be given numbersAsks for the specific number that would change the answer
CommunicationThinks silently, then presentsNarrates the reasoning as it forms
RecommendationTrails off without concludingCommits to a call, names the risk in it

A repeatable structure

  1. 1
    Clarify the objective and the constraint. What are we optimising, and what can't we touch?
  2. 2
    Restate the problem back. This catches misunderstandings while they're still cheap.
  3. 3
    Break it into 3–4 drivers that don't overlap. Say them out loud before going deep.
  4. 4
    State a hypothesis. "My instinct is it's X — let me test that." This is what separates senior candidates.
  5. 5
    Go depth-first on the branch that matters most, not left-to-right through everything.
  6. 6
    Name what would change your mind, then recommend anyway.
The most common failure isn't a wrong answer. It's a candidate who explores every branch evenly, runs out of time, and never commits to a recommendation.

A case, worked end to end

This is a case I was given, worked through the way I'd approach it now. I've reconstructed the figures from memory rather than from a transcript — the shape of the data is right, the exact numbers are illustrative. What matters here isn't the arithmetic, it's the sequence: what I asked, in what order, and how each answer changed where I looked next.

The case

You've been asked by the Head of People to solve two problems for backend developer hiring: reduce time to hire, and increase the hire conversion rate. You have 30 minutes.

The interviewer had data — but only released it if I asked a question specific enough to deserve it. Vague questions got "I don't have data for that." That constraint is the whole test. You're not being scored on knowing the answer; you're being scored on whether your questions are aimed at anything.

Step 1 — Clarify before structuring

The answers: both matter, measured from first contact, no fixed target. That last one is useful — no fixed target means I need to find where the loss is concentrated rather than chase a number.

Step 2 — Restate

"So: we're losing backend candidates somewhere between first contact and signature, and the process is slower than we want. I want to find where the time goes and where the people go, and check whether those are the same place."

Cheap to say, and it caught something — the interviewer reacted to "whether those are the same place." That turned out to be the case.

Step 3 — Three buckets

I split the problem three ways:

An honest note on this: these overlap more than I'd like. Scheduling sits in Internal but is also a process problem; compensation sits in External but the bands are an internal decision. A cleaner cut would have been by funnel stage, with each stage carrying both a duration and a pass rate. It worked, but I'd structure it differently now — and being able to say that is worth more in the room than pretending the first cut was perfect.

Step 4 — The questions, and what came back

"What does the funnel look like, stage by stage — volumes, conversion, and days spent in each stage?"

This was the question that unlocked the case. Asking for days and conversion in the same breath is what made the rest work.

StageEnteredPassedConversionMedian days
Applications + sourced1,00020020%3
CV screen → recruiter call20012060%5
Recruiter screen → tech screen1207058%12
Tech screen → onsite loop703043%9
Onsite loop → offer301447%8
Offer → accept14750%6
End to end1,00070.7%43 days

Two numbers are outliers, and neither is in the middle of the funnel: 12 days waiting for a technical screen, and a 50% offer-accept rate against a healthy 70–90%.

"What tools are we using, and is anything broken?"

AreaState
ATSIn place, working
SchedulingManual — recruiter emails engineers for availability
Qualified interviewer pool6 engineers
Technical screen formatLive, requires a senior engineer

Nothing was broken. That mattered — it moved the 12 days out of the System bucket and into Internal. It's a capacity problem, not a tooling one.

"Do we have feedback from candidates who dropped out at the bottom of the funnel?"

Reason given for decliningCount (of 7)
Compensation below their alternative4
Had already accepted elsewhere2
Role scope / team1

"What are competitors offering — are we short?"

Roughly 12–15% below the competitor set on total compensation for equivalent seniority.

The questions that got nothing

Not every question landed. Asking about employer brand and about long-term attrition both got "I don't have data for that." Both were me drifting toward interesting-but-out-of-scope, and neither would have changed the recommendation. Worth saying out loud because the round is partly about noticing you've wandered and coming back without losing the thread.

Step 5 — The branch that mattered

Here's what the data gives you, and it's the whole case: the two problems aren't separate.

Two of the seven declines had already accepted elsewhere. That isn't a compensation loss — that's a 43-day cycle losing a race. Speed isn't just the first problem, it's a cause of the second one.

So the hypothesis I committed to: time-to-hire is the dominant driver, because it damages both metrics, and the 12-day scheduling gap is the single largest recoverable block of it. I went depth-first there instead of touring the other branches.

Step 6 — Recommendation, and the risk in it

Priority 1 — interviewer capacity and scheduling. Six engineers, manually coordinated, creates the 12-day gap. Widening the pool and moving to self-serve booking attacks 12 of 43 days and recovers roughly 2 of 7 declines. It's the cheapest intervention and the only one that moves both metrics.

Priority 2 — compensation band review. Being 12–15% short explains 4 of 7 declines. It recovers more offers than Priority 1, but costs materially more and moves only one metric.

Everything else is noise at this stage. A 20% application-to-screen rate looks low, but with 1,000 applications the top of the funnel isn't where the constraint is.

The risk in my own recommendation: widening the interviewer pool to cut the wait is exactly how you dilute a hiring bar. The 43% technical-screen pass rate is the guardrail — if it starts climbing after the pool expands, that's not improvement, that's the bar slipping. I'd want it tracked from day one.

What I'd do differently

I spent too long on the System bucket before asking for the funnel. The funnel question is the one that opens the case, and I should have led with it — the tooling questions only became meaningful after I knew where the days were going.

Frequently asked questions

What is the Revolut problem-solving interview?

A 45–60 minute live case discussion where you're given an ambiguous business problem — typically about growth, a metric decline, or an operational trade-off — and assessed on how you structure and reason through it rather than on reaching a specific answer.

How do I prepare for the Revolut problem-solving round?

Practise structuring problems out loud under time pressure rather than memorising frameworks. Work through cases where you clarify the goal, name three or four non-overlapping drivers, state a hypothesis early, and finish with a recommendation and its main risk.

Is the Revolut problem-solving interview like a consulting case?

It's similar in structure but usually data-light and more product- or operations-flavoured. The emphasis is on logic, prioritisation and business intuition rather than on detailed quantitative modelling.

What happens if I get the answer wrong?

There generally isn't a single right answer. Candidates are assessed on structure, prioritisation and how they respond to new information, so a defensible recommendation reached through clear reasoning scores well even if the interviewer would have concluded differently.
